84115502 Overview

AC INPUT MODULE 240V

84115502 Parametric

Parameter NameAttribute value
typeAC input module
coloryellow
styleDIN rail mounting
Voltage - input240VAC
Current - input5mA
Voltage - Output4.5 ~ 30VDC
Current - Output32mA
connection time20ms
Off time20ms
characteristicStatus display LED

GMS SERIES 17.5mm INPUT MODULES
DIN Rail Mountable Single Point Input Modules
AC Inputs (Yellow Top), DC Inputs (White Top)
UL, cUL Recognized, CE Compliant
4kV Optical isolation
Input and Output Barrier Strips Accept 14 to 28
AWG Wire
Open-Collector Output, with LED Status Indicator
